The love gift box with a lid is one of the most suitable packaging for Valentine’s Day gifts~ Have you ever thought about making one yourself? Sharing a very detailed tutorial on origami boxes, please read on if you are interested~
1. Fold the long side of the A4 paper in half and cut it in half. Use one half to fold the box body and the other half to fold the box lid.
2. Put the long side of the rectangle facing you. If there is a flowery side, put the flowery side down. Fold the rectangle in half up and down, and open it, leaving a long center line.
3. Fold the top edge to the center line and open it to leave a 1/4 line. Then align the lower right corner with the upper edge, press out the upper half of the upper right corner bisector, open it, and you can see the intersection between the corner bisector and the center line. Fold the right half to the left past the intersection point.
4. Align the upper right corner with the 1/4 line and fold it down, and the lower right corner with the 1/4 line and fold it open.
5.Fold the upper 1/4 strip downward and pull the crease on the upper edge of the small rectangle to the right to get a shape like this.
6. Fold the long strip in the middle of the small rectangle upward, and align the lower diagonal crease with the midline and flatten it.
7. Keep the lower fold unchanged, pull out the upper edge at a right angle, flatten it, then press the raised part in the middle under the long strip, and turn the long strip downward. to the back.

8.Turn over, fold the right side of the rectangle to the left side, and fold the lower right corner to the midline. Fold the right half to the left along the vertical edge of the folded triangle, leaving a crease before opening. , so that both left and right sides form a rectangular part.
9. For the right rectangle, align the right side with the left side, fold it in half again, and open it to get four small strips.
11. Fold the diagonal creases of four rectangles in the same direction as the diagonal lines of the middle square.
12. Turn over, make the upper part of the long strip upright and pull the diagonal lines of the square together, press the triangle formed in the middle to one side, then align the upper part with the midline and fold it, open it, and start from Fold in the middle.
13. Fold the lower two sides toward the center line to get a small diamond shape, and open it to leave a crease.
14. Pull the upper part upward, align the left and right edges of the lower part with the crease and press in along the center line. After flattening, a corner will be formed at the upper part.
15.Open the diamond shape and press the small triangle on top into the inside to form a triangular pouch.
16. Fold the left side first, press the first diagonal line to the right along the vertical crease, and press the remaining three diagonal lines in the same way.
17. The right one is similar to the left one, fold the diagonal line to the left along the vertical crease.
18. Put the folded part into the triangular pouch, and then adjust the joint opening so that the front and back sides can be brought together, and use double-sided tape to fix the interface. Then recess the upper corner of the back inwards. In this way, the box body part is ready.
19.Take another rectangular piece of paper and make the lid. Fold the top edge down, leaving a distance of about 2mm, and open it to leave a crease.
20. Align the top edge with the crease and fold it downward, open it, align the top right corner with the newly folded crease, and fold the top right edge to the left.
21. Fold the right part of the strip back through the triangle point, open all the creases, and fold it from top to left.
22. Repeat steps 4-7.
23.Turn it over and fold down the excess rectangular strip on the left.
24. Repeat the remaining steps of folding the box body to get a heart-shaped lid. Have you folded it? Try to see if they can be put together!
